What is the equation of the line that passes through the point (-4,1) and has a
slope of -3/4

Respuesta :

Zelath
Zelath Zelath
  • 21-11-2020

Answer:

y = -3/4x - 2

Step-by-step explanation:

y = -3/4x + b

1 = (-3/4) × -4 + b

1 = 3 + b

-2 = b

b = -2

y = -3/4x -2
